In page Atomic absorption spectroscopy:

"

The requirement for samples of glow discharge atomizers is that they are electrical conductors. Consequently, atomizers are most commonly used in the analysis of metals and other conducting samples. However, with proper modifications, it can be used to analyze liquid samples as well as nonconducting materials by mixing them with a conductor (e.g. graphite).[citation needed]
